Apex Hotels in London is seeking a Food and Beverage Assistant to join their vibrant team. In this role, you will have the opportunity to work across various service areas, including bars and restaurants, while providing exceptional guest experiences. Training will be provided to help you develop your skills as part of our family-oriented environment.

You will enjoy benefits such as 29 days of holiday, employee events, and discounts on spa treatments and hotel stays. Bring your unique personality to work and contribute to a welcoming atmosphere that guests love.

How to prepare for a job interview at Apex Hotels

Know the Company

Before your interview, take some time to research Apex Hotels. Understand their values, mission, and what makes them unique in the hospitality industry.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show your genuine interest in being part of their vibrant team.

Showcase Your Personality

As a Guest-Centric Food & Beverage Assistant, your personality is key! Be yourself during the interview and let your enthusiasm for providing exceptional guest experiences shine through. Share personal anecdotes that highlight your customer service skills and how you create a welcoming atmosphere.

Prepare for Role-Specific Questions

Expect questions related to food and beverage service, such as how you would handle difficult guests or manage busy service periods. Think of specific examples from your past experiences that demonstrate your 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ment while maintaining high service standards.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the training provided, employee events, or how they foster a family-oriented environment. This shows that you’re not just interested in the job, but also in becoming an integral part of their team.
